WebHead Start and Early Head Start services are provided at no cost to families who qualify. Early Head Start serves children from birth until they are 3 years old, as well as expectant mothers. Head Start serves children who are 3 to 4 years old by September 1, or no older than 5 years old after September 1. Head Start services are for families ... WebHead Start programs serve children between 3 and 5 years old. These programs are run by local nonprofit organizations, community action agencies, and school districts.
